Reinforced armored vehicle front impact frame
Technical Field
The utility model relates to an armoured vehicle technical field, more specifically says, the utility model relates to an striking frame before enhancement mode armoured vehicle.
Background
The armored vehicle is a general name of various caterpillar or wheeled military vehicles with armored protection, is a military or police vehicle with armored, and the tank is also one of armored vehicle caterpillar armored vehicles, but is usually classified separately due to combat application in habit, and most armored vehicles refer to vehicles with weaker protective force and firepower than the tank, and the armored vehicle has the characteristic of strong destructive force, and can directly pass through some building barriers in an impact mode, so that the front impact frame structure of the armored vehicle is very important.
The front impact frame structure of the armored vehicle at the present stage is inconvenient to assemble and disassemble with the armored vehicle body, and although the acting force is dispersed by using the stress mode of the whole vehicle after impact, the impact frame is generally damaged and inconvenient to replace after long-time use, so that the front impact frame of the reinforced armored vehicle needs to be designed.

Drawings
Fig. 1 is a schematic structural diagram of the present invention.
Fig. 2 is a schematic view of the connection structure of the front impact frame of the present invention.
Fig. 3 is a schematic view of the connection structure of the middle cone head and the mounting plate of the present invention.
Fig. 4 is a schematic structural view of the armored vehicle body of the present invention.
The reference signs are: 1. an armored car body; 2. a vertical plate; 3. a transverse plate; 4. a side fixing plate; 5. a first locking bolt; 6. a screw; 7. a pyramid block; 8. a second lock bolt; 9. mounting a plate; 10. a conical head; 11. a through hole; 12. a first screw hole; 13. a second screw hole; 14. a third screw hole; 15. a fourth screw hole; 16. and a third locking bolt.

The reinforced armored vehicle front impact frame comprises an armored vehicle body 1, one end of the armored vehicle body 1 is connected with an L-shaped plate, the L-shaped plate is composed of a vertical plate 2 and a transverse plate 3 horizontally arranged at the bottom of the vertical plate 2, the front end of the vertical plate 2 is fixedly connected with a pyramid block 7, the front end of the pyramid block 7 is connected with a mounting plate 9, the front end of the mounting plate 9 is provided with a cone head 10, the bottom of the armored vehicle body 1 is provided with a plurality of screw rods 6 inserted into the transverse plate 3 in the vertical direction, two side ends of the vertical plate 2 are located on two sides of the front end of the armored vehicle body 1 and fixedly connected with side fixing plates 4, and the side fixing plates 4 are provided with first locking bolts 5 fixedly locked with the armored vehicle body 1.
As shown in the attached drawings 1-2, a through hole 11 for a screw rod 6 to pass through is formed in the transverse plate 3, and a nut for locking is arranged at the position, located at the bottom of the transverse plate 3, outside the screw rod 6, so that the transverse plate 3 and the armored car body 1 can be conveniently connected and fixed, and the connection effect of the L-shaped plate and the armored car body 1 can be conveniently increased.
As shown in the attached drawings 1-4, a second locking bolt 8 used for being locked and fixed with the front end part of the armored vehicle body 1 is arranged at the bottom of the vertical plate 2, a second screw hole 13 is formed in the portion, corresponding to the outside of the second locking bolt 8, inside the vertical plate 2, and an internal thread groove structure corresponding to the position of the second screw hole 13 is arranged at the front end part of the armored vehicle body 1, so that the vertical plate 2 and the armored vehicle body 1 are conveniently connected and fixed, and further the connection effect of the L-shaped plate and the armored vehicle body 1 is further improved.
As shown in fig. 1-2 and fig. 4, the side fixing plate 4 is a steel plate structure, the side fixing plate 4 and the vertical plate 2 are welded and fixed, a first screw hole 12 is formed in the side fixing plate 4 and outside the joint corresponding to the first locking bolt 5, and fourth screw holes 15 are formed in the two outer side walls of the front end portion of the armored car body 1 and inside the first screw holes 12, so that the side fixing plate 4 and the armored car body 1 are connected and fixed conveniently, and the connection effect of the L-shaped plate and the armored car body 1 is improved.
As shown in fig. 1-3, third locking bolts 16 are connected between the two end portions of the mounting plate 9 and the pyramid block 7 and between the two end portions of the pyramid block 7, and third screw holes 14 are formed in the mounting plate 9 and the pyramid block 7 at positions corresponding to the outer portions of the connection portions of the third locking bolts 16, so that the mounting plate 9 and the pyramid block 7 can be conveniently connected and detached.
As shown in fig. 1-3, the cone head 10 is a triangular pyramid structure, and the cone head 10 is welded and fixed to the outer wall of the mounting plate 9.
